A domain name is the Internet address of a website or blog. (For example, cpwebhosting.com is the domain name of this site.) You’ll need to choose a domain name. Your domain name should be simple, obvious, and as short as possible.
It’s more important to make your domain name memorable and speakable than it is to make it accurate. Don’t stuff your whole business name into your domain name. Don’t use numbers or dashes (without perfect reason).

The important points to remember while choosing the best website hosting is:
- Uptime: You must choose the host with uptime nearly up to 100%.
- Support: It is a very crucial part of the web hosting company. Because if you get stuck in any problem, then the customer support of the hosting company will help you out of the problem.
- Reliability: For sure your business will grow gradually and may be shortly you need to upgrade your plan or need to transfer, so make sure before buying that you can easily upgrade your hosting plan or you can quickly move to new place. Also, keep in mind the price of next plan you may need in future.
- Price: One of the most important part, many hosting companies gives you cheap rate, but then you will surely need to compromise in services then, so don’t go with that, choose the one those who offer quality over quantity. You can use many online tools to compare prices and find the best plan for you and make sure you are getting best price and service.
- Hosting features: Make sure that hosting company is offering all latest tools like Cpanel, Softaculous, etc.

Once you have a hosting provider, you still need to move your files from your local hard drive to the hosting computer. Many hosting companies provide an online data management tool that you can use to upload your records. But if they don’t, you can also use FTP to transfer your records. Talk to your hosting provider if you have specific questions about how to get your files to their server.

Some steps that will guide you to upload the website:
- Decide where you are going to put your pages.
- Find out the details of your account: your username, your password, the “hostname” (the machine where you’ll upload your files), and your URL or Web address
- Connect to the Internet
- Open up an FTP program (like Fetch – Mac or WS-FTP – PC)
- Put in the hostname of your Web site
- Put in your username
- Put in your password
- Connect to the site
- Highlight the files you would like on your Web site
- Click on the option to transfer them to your Web site.

When you create a website, whatever your goal is, the primary purpose of a website is to be seen by large masses online. The term website traffic refers to the sum of all the visitors to your site. Of course, you want to know how many visitors you have. To be able to do that you need to know how to check your website traffic.
Steps of monitoring the web traffic:
- Install a hit counter: A hit counter is a code that you put on your web page, which counts how many times the page being viewed.
- Use Google Analytics: Google provides this tool if you have a Google account of course, which not only tells you how many times your site has been viewed but also gives you all kind of information about your site visitors, their locations, loyalty, etc.
- Check Alexa: Alexa also tells you about your site traffic and it gives you all kind of valuable data about your site.
- A lot of other online services offer to count your website’s visitors if you create an account with them.

- cPanel is a Unix based web hosting control panel that provides a graphical interface and automation tools designed to simplify the process of hosting a website.
- cPanel utilizes a 3 tier structure that provides functionality for administrators, resellers, and end-user website owners to control the various aspects of website and server administration through a standard web browser.
- In addition to the GUI interface, cpanel also has command line and API based access that allows third party software vendors, web hosting organizations, and developers to automate standard system administration processes.
- To the client, Cpanel provides front-ends for some standard operations, including the management of PGP keys, crontab tasks, mail and FTP accounts, and mailing lists.
Some of the commonly available modules in most control panels:
- Access to server logs.
- Details of available and used web space and bandwidth.
- Email account configuration.
- Maintaining FTP users’ accounts.
- Managing database.
- Visitor statistics using web log analysis software.
- Web-based file manager.

Record your pertinent site information: Be sure that you know your login and password information. It may include some or all of the following:
- Login information for email accounts and any additional information such as email groups and email aliases
- Content management system login
- Hosting control panel login
- Domain registrar web address and login
FTP login information: You should also have the customer support phone numbers, email and other contact information for your website hosting provider.
- Perform and save regular backups of your site: Most hosting companies and application service providers back up their server data regularly. However, you should maintain your backups in case there is an emergency, or you need to move to another provider quickly.Many hosting companies offer the ability for you to back up your website through your hosting control panel, such as Plesk. It is also a good idea to keep copies of all of your files (i.e., images, videos, etc.) as well as the text of your website in an easily accessible location should a need for them arise.
- Determine an implementation plan for recovering your site: Understanding what you will need to do in case of an emergency will help ensure a smoother recovery. Be sure to keep your backup data and login information accessible, and determine who will be in charge of restoring the backups or uploading the files to your new website.
- Keep an extra copy of your website data in a safe place
Make sure that you have an extra copy stored off-site in case your main office is inaccessible. It might be in a safe-deposit box at a local bank, or for some small organizations, and it may be at a trusted employee’s home. You might even backup the data to an off-site backup service.
